Name: Streptomyces stelliscabiei Bouchek-Mechiche et al. 2000
Etymology: stel.li.sca’bi.ei. L. masc. perf. part. stellatus, star; L. fem. n. scabies, mange; N.L. gen. fem. n. stelliscabiei, referring to lesions from which these strains were isolated, which look like stars
Type strain: CFBP 4521; CIP 107060; CIP 107126; DSM 41803; ICMP 13715; NCPPB 4040

Valid publication:
Bouchek-Mechiche K, Gardan L, Normand P, Jouan B. DNA relatedness among strains of Streptomyces pathogenic to potato in France: description of three new species, S. europaeiscabiei sp. nov. and S. stelliscabiei sp. nov. associated with common scab, and S. reticuliscabiei sp. nov. associated with netted scab. Int J Syst Evol Microbiol 2000; 50:91-99.
IJSEM list:
Anonymous. Notification list. Notification that new names and new combinations have appeared in volume 50, part 1 of the IJSEM. Int J Syst Evol Microbiol 2000; 50:425-426.
Nomenclatural status: validly published under the ICNP
Taxonomic status: synonym (and not recommended for medical use)
Correct name: Streptomyces bottropensis Waksman 1961 (Approved Lists 1980)
